Draining An Abscess In The Roof Of The Mouth

Connecticut rates for HCPCS 42000

Opens and drains a pocket of pus, fluid or blood in the roof of the mouth or in the uvula, the small flap that hangs at the back of the throat. A cut is made through the lining, the collection is emptied and the area is rinsed out. It relieves pain, pressure and swelling that can make swallowing difficult.
